1982 Land Rover Range Rover 'Popemobile' by Ogle

The first bulletproof Popemobile was built following the first assassination attempt on John Paul II in 1981. The British design firm of Ogle crafted the first bulletproof Popemobile on a Range Rover chassis. The Rover took the precedent set in the design of the 230 G and enclosed the cabin, adding bulletproof glass for a visit to the UK. The raised “telephone booth” at the rear raises the car's overall height to 102 inches.
